John McCallister (born 20 February 1972) is a Northern Irish Unionist politician.
In 2007, he was elected to the Northern Ireland Assembly as an Ulster Unionist Party (UUP) member for South Down.
On 14 February 2013, McCallister announced that he had resigned from the UUP due to its decision to engage in an electoral pact with the Democratic Unionist Party.
He was a co-founder of the NI21 party with fellow ex-UUP member Basil McCrea but resigned the following year following disputes with McCrea.
He re-contested his seat as an Independent at the 2016 election but lost his seat, receiving just 2.8% of the vote.
